Thom Vernon knew he wanted refrigerators with a vintage look, but was also modern. He reached out to his nephew Orion Creamer who had just graduated from a Denver design school. Together, they designed the Big Chill retro refrigerator, which blends classic style and color with modern appliances.

No matter what style you pick, it is essential to keep your retro refrigerator freezer on a regular basis. Dish soap and hot water are the best method to clean the removable racks, drawers, and shelves. Make sure you clean the rubber gasket on the door of your fridge as well. To ensure a tight seal, it must be clean and free from mold and mildew. You can clean it with a damp sponge or cloth, or cover any spills using a nonabrasive cleanser ($5 Target). In the freezer, you can remove the ice tray and clean it frequently.
